ICSE/CBSE Science Exhibition
Guide to creating a winning science project for school exhibitions
Preparation Roadmap
Follow these steps to prepare systematically
Choose a Relevant Topic
Pick a topic that solves a real problem — water purification, renewable energy, waste management, health tech. Check the annual theme.
Research & Plan
Study existing solutions. Define your hypothesis. Plan materials, budget, and timeline. Write a project proposal.
Build Your Model/Experiment
Create a working model or conduct experiments. Document every step with photos and data. Keep it neat and functional.
Prepare Display & Report
Create an attractive display board. Write a clear project report with aim, materials, procedure, observations, and conclusion.
Practice Presentation
Rehearse explaining your project in 5-7 minutes. Anticipate judge questions. Be confident and clear about your methodology.

Pro Tips
- Innovation matters more than complexity
- Working models score higher than static displays
- Connect your project to UN SDGs for extra impact
- Team projects are allowed — divide work smartly
